嵌入式系统学习杂记
1, 简单高效的解决中断引起的并发2, 屏蔽中断应尽量使用local_irq_save和local_irq_restore3, 中断屏蔽的时间不宜过长, 因为中断必须执行完才会继续调度4, 只能屏蔽本地cpu中断, 对于对称多处理器 SMP, CPU之间的竞态继续存在1, 利用了汇编的不可分割性, 和cpu架构密切相关, 汇编不直接支持就用中断屏蔽等手段2, 只能用于整形变量 int, 能使用的时候尽量使用, 比任何锁和屏蔽消耗少3, 还有位原子操作// 追//设置上限。
原创
2023-11-02 13:46:17 ·
371 阅读 ·
0 评论